What will be the easily and quickest solution to choice specifications for a new BMW in the future? The answer is the new product navigator, based on Microsoft Surface. This technology provides a real multi-touch experience. Users can grab digital information with their hands and interact with content by touch.
Franz Wimmer – Innovation Manager Of BMW Group — The BMW Product Navigator is fun.
Potential BMW buyers can change colors, rims, and seat covers by placing samples on the surface. They can also change the visual angle. Accessories can be added very easily. The vertical screens displays the current configuration of the car, related images, and video in a 360 degree view.
All information can be printed out on the spot, send by emailed to the user, or saved to a USB drive and viewed at home. BMW is the first car manufacturer worldwide to use this technology commercially.
What is Microsoft Surface
Microsoft Surface, also known as Milan is a touch product developed as a software/hardware combination that allows manipulation of digital content.
